Newton is trying to deal with a different kind of problem: what happens when systems donโt just execute transactions, but act on behalf of users through automation and AI agents. That sounds simple until you actually think about control, permissions, and limits without making everything unusable.
The idea makes sense because DeFi is still very manual. Too many steps, too much repetition. Automation is already happening, just in messy, unofficial ways. So putting structure around it isnโt meaningless.
But structure always has a cost. You reduce friction in one place and add complexity somewhere else. And even if it works, adoption is never guaranteed. Liquidity doesnโt move easily. People donโt migrate just because something is cleaner.

What I find more interesting is that OpenGradient seems to focus on the infrastructure behind decentralized AI instead of simply using AI as a narrative. If AI is going to play a meaningful role onchain, then hosting models, running inference, and verifying outputs probably matter more than another token claiming to be AI-powered.
We've already seen how difficult scaling can be. Even strong ecosystems like Solana have shown that performance under normal conditions and performance during heavy demand are two very different things. Every network eventually has to prove itself under real usage, not just benchmarks.
The bigger question isn't whether OpenGradient's design makes sense. It's whether developers and users have enough reason to build and move there. Technology alone rarely changes behavior, and liquidity usually stays where it's already comfortable.
